Introduction / Context:
This is a unit-consistent division problem: total length divided by length per piece gives the number of pieces. Converting to decimals and dividing carefully yields the exact integer count when the division is exact.
Given Data / Assumptions:
Concept / Approach:
Pieces = total length / piece length. Because 3.2 = 32/10, the division can be simplified by scaling both numerator and denominator to remove the decimal, which keeps arithmetic clean and reduces error risk.
Step-by-Step Solution:
1) Compute number of pieces: 192 / 3.2.2) Multiply numerator and denominator by 10 to clear the decimal: (1920) / 32.3) Divide: 1920 / 32 = 60 (since 32 × 60 = 1920).4) Therefore, 60 pieces are obtained.
Verification / Alternative check:
Multiply back: 60 × 3.2 m = 192 m, matching the original length exactly, so the count is confirmed.
Why Other Options Are Wrong:
52, 62, and 68 correspond to misdivisions (for example, using 3 or 3.1 instead of 3.2) or arithmetic slips. “None of these” is incorrect since an exact correct option is provided.
Common Pitfalls:
Dividing by 3 instead of 3.2; dropping the decimal when scaling; rounding prematurely; forgetting to verify by multiplication.
